My Chevy Titan with Lifestock Trailer.

The truck started out of the trash and some parts were lost. Also, in the "partsbag" were parts, they wont fit to it - but: i love challenges!

So my plan was from the beginning, to make a used truck. A little bit of rust, a little bit of rubbish in the cabin...

Next part was the trailer that was built and attached to a Marmon truck. I took it from the shelf and had only to make a paintjob. Two times. No big thing, just to try it.
